高效的计算机性能依赖于各个组件的协调工作,其中CPU作为核心处理单元,发挥着举足轻重的作用。CPU使用率过高的问题时常困扰着用户,影响系统的响应速度和用户体验。理解CPU高使用率的原因,并采取有效措施进行处理,对于提升系统性能至关重要。

多种因素可以导致程序占用CPU过高。常见的原因包括:
1. 程序设计缺陷:某些软件在设计时未能优化,导致在特定条件下进入死循环或者过度调用系统资源。例如,一些游戏或图像处理软件在处理高负载时,可能会导致CPU占用飙升。
2. 恶意软件的存在:病毒和木马程序往往会在用户不知情的情况下占用大量CPU资源。这类程序不仅影响日常操作,还可能引发隐私泄露和数据损坏的风险。
3. 后台程序的过度运行:许多应用程序会在后台执行更新或同步任务,这些任务在某些情况下会占用显著的CPU资源。它们虽然在表面上不会干扰用户操作,但实际上会拖慢系统的整体性能。
4. 硬件问题:当CPU的散热系统工作不良时,CPU可能会因为过热而自动降低频率,进而影响性能表现。有时候,过时的硬件也会导致新软件无法高效运行。
5. 操作系统本身的缺陷或更新:有时操作系统的更新版本可能并未经过充分测试,导致新漏洞被利用,从而使一些系统进程消耗过高的CPU资源。
为了降低CPU的使用率,用户可以采取以下几种方法:
- 监测系统资源:使用Windows任务管理器或第三方工具(如Process Explorer)监控各个进程的CPU使用情况。识别占用资源过高的程序是解决问题的第一步。
- 优化启动项和后台程序:通过系统设置或使用专门的软件,禁用不必要的启动项,减少开机后自动运行的程序数量。
- 查杀恶意软件:定期使用可靠的安全软件进行全面扫描,查找并清除潜在的病毒和木马。
- 更新驱动程序:确保所有硬件驱动程序和操作系统都是最新版本,系统更新常常会修复导致高CPU占用的已知问题。
- 检查硬件状态:可以考虑更换或清洁散热系统,确保CPU可以在最佳条件下运行。如果系统本身较为陈旧,考虑进行升级或更换硬件,增强整体性能。
结束时,不妨看看一些相关的常见问题,帮助用户更好地理解和应对CPU高使用率的问题:
1. 如何查看哪些程序占用CPU最多?
- 可以通过任务管理器中的进程选项卡,按CPU使用率排序查看。
2. 高CPU使用率会对电脑有害吗?
- 长期高CPU使用率可能导致系统过热,影响硬件寿命,甚至造成数据丢失。
3. 定期清理系统的重要性有哪些?
- 清理能帮助消除不必要的文件和程序,释放系统资源,降低CPU负担。
4. 是否需要更换计算机?
- 如果CPU常常处于高负载状态且影响使用体验,可以考虑更换更强大的硬件,特别是在进行高强度运算时。
5. 如何判断是否为软件问题?
- 可启动安全模式,观察CPU使用率是否异常,若在安全模式下正常,则问题可能出在某个自启软件上。
